Earliest 1744-

Three Compasses

Latest 1785

7 The Stade/48 Radnor Street

Folkestone

 

This may have been the "Carpenter's Arms" originally, but to date there is no hard evidence to prove this theory.

From the Kentish Gazette, February 21 – 24, 1759. Kindly sent from Alec Hasenson.

Cutter for sale at the Sign of the Three Compasses at Folkestone, 26th February.
